Transaction 16a70f1dc5912ffeff33dc3aa4fd4b3cba72126847367bf15214d54eaae04242
1 Input
2 Outputs
- 16a70f1dc5912ffeff33dc3aa4fd4b3cba72126847367bf15214d54eaae04242:0
- 16a70f1dc5912ffeff33dc3aa4fd4b3cba72126847367bf15214d54eaae04242:1
value 1973647
address 387Kf63Ze9NDeH4qWkq69Rf2w8wM7WsmDK
value 63622058
address 1BcYX5Y5tFa29Eo1Ef34wZKrjnj3U62T9P